History and Myth of Meeks Bay Hiking

Meeks Bay has a rich history that dates back centuries. Native American tribes, such as the Washoe and Paiute, inhabited the area and relied on its resources for survival. The bay was named after John Meeks, an early settler who established a trading post in the area in the mid-19th century.

Legend has it that Meeks Bay is also home to a mythical creature known as the Tahoe Tessie. According to local folklore, Tahoe Tessie is a large serpent-like creature that resides in the depths of Lake Tahoe. While there have been numerous sightings and stories about Tahoe Tessie, there is no scientific evidence to support its existence.

Listicle of Meeks Bay Hiking

1. Eagle Lake Trail: This trail is a moderate hike that offers stunning views of Eagle Lake and the surrounding mountains. The trail is approximately 2.3 miles round trip, with an elevation gain of 500 feet.

2. Rubicon Trail: This trail is a longer hike that follows the shoreline of Lake Tahoe. It offers breathtaking views of the lake and takes hikers through diverse terrain. The trail is approximately 14 miles round trip, with an elevation gain of 1,700 feet.

3. Crag Lake Trail: This trail is a challenging hike that rewards hikers with panoramic views of Crag Lake and the surrounding wilderness. The trail is approximately 8 miles round trip, with an elevation gain of 2,000 feet.

4. Cascade Falls Trail: This trail is a popular hike that leads to a beautiful waterfall. The trail is relatively short and easy, making it suitable for hikers of all skill levels. The trail is approximately 1.5 miles round trip, with an elevation gain of 200 feet.
